【Uniapp-Vue3】request各种不同类型的参数详解

一、参数携带

我们调用该接口的时候需要传入type参数。

第一种

路径名称?参数名1=参数值1&参数名2=参数值2

第二种

uni.request({

url:"请求路径",

data:{

参数名:参数值

}

})

二、请求方式

常用的有get,post和put 三种,默认是get请求。

uni.request({

url:"请求路径",

method:"方式"

})

三、请求头配置

uni.request({

url:"请求路径",

header:{

token:"xxx",

"content-type":"xxx"

}

})

四、请求超时和回调

uni.request({

url:"请求路径",

timeout:xxx, // 设置超时,毫秒为单位

success:res=>{...} // 成功的回调

fail:err=>{...} // 失败的回调

complete:()=>{...} // 无论成功还是失败都会触发此回调

})

相关推荐
Zhu_S W10 分钟前
基于Java和Redis实现排行榜功能
前端·bootstrap·html
那些免费的砖22 分钟前
Uni ECharts - 基于 ECharts 开发的 uni-app 跨端图表解决方案,和 Vue ECharts 用法几乎一致
vue.js·uni-app·echarts
小马_xiaoen28 分钟前
Vue3 + TS 实现长按指令 v-longPress:优雅解决移动端/PC端长按交互需求
前端·javascript·vue.js·typescript
木子啊38 分钟前
Uni-app rpx布局终极指南
uni-app·rpx·微信小程序rpx
147API40 分钟前
改名后的24小时:npm 包抢注如何劫持开源项目供应链
前端·npm·node.js
ziqi52243 分钟前
第二十二天笔记
前端·chrome·笔记
鹤归时起雾.43 分钟前
react一阶段学习
前端·学习·react.js
2301_780669861 小时前
HTML-CSS-常见标签和样式(标题的排版、标题的样式、选择器、正文的排版、正文的样式、整体布局、盒子模型)
前端·css·html·javaweb
mseaspring1 小时前
一款高颜值SSH终端工具!基于Electron+Vue3开发,开源免费还好用
运维·前端·javascript·electron·ssh
appearappear1 小时前
wkhtmltopdf把 html 原生转成成 pdf
前端·pdf·html